Reverse description The reverse is covered overall with a dense typeset underprint of repeating Cyrillic text reading двадцать пять рублей across multiple horizontal registers, interspersed with rows of alphanumeric characters serving as a primitive security pattern. At centre, a circular guilloche vignette surrounds the large numeral 25, with radiating Cyrillic text. Two text blocks flanking the central vignette state the conditions of exchange and the equivalence of the note's value to the gold rouble of 1915, and a bold Cyrillic anti-counterfeiting warning is printed across the lower portion.

The Sakhalin Oblast People's Revolutionary Committee was a short-lived Bolshevik authority operating on the northern half of the island while Japanese forces held the south following their 1920 intervention. This note is among the most geographically isolated emergency issues from the entire Russian Civil War period — Sakhalin was, by any practical measure, cut off from the monetary supply chains sustaining other Red administrations in the Far East.

Production was almost certainly local and improvised. Surviving examples are genuinely rare, and the committee itself ceased to function within months of issue.
